Cross Spider Extermination Questions
What are cross spiders? Cross spiders are a type of orb-weaver known for the distinctive cross pattern on their backs. They are common in residential areas around Frisco, TX.
Why are cross spiders a concern for property owners? While generally harmless, cross spiders can become a nuisance by creating webs in outdoor and indoor spaces, affecting the appearance of the property.
How are cross spider infestations typically managed? Management involves removing webs, sealing entry points, and applying targeted treatments to reduce spider activity around the property.
When should property owners consider professional extermination? Professional services are recommended when spider webs become persistent or difficult to control with DIY methods, especially in high-traffic areas.
